If one zero of the polynomial -2x² +3kx-10 is 1 then value of k will be​

Answer:

4

Step-by-step explanation:

-2x^2 +3kx- 10 = p[x]

-2*1^2 + 3k -10 = p[1]

-12 + 3k = 0

3k = 12

k= 12/3

k = 4
